Nine months after its launch, our new passport has just been selected as "one of the most influential projects of 2022" by the Project Management Institute (PMI), which has devoted a wonderful report to it.

By compiling an annual list of the top 50 projects, PMI's goal is to "highlight the world's most ambitious and innovative initiatives and how they are being achieved."

Being cited by the PMI: a global reference!

Founded in the United States in 1969, the Project Management Institute (PMI) is the leading professional project management association and the authority for a global community of millions of professionals for whom the Institute provides networking, collaboration, research and education.
